What companies run services between Wishaw, Scotland and Bathgate, Scotland?

You can take a train from Wishaw to Bathgate via Glasgow Central and Glasgow Queen Street Low Level in around 1h 51m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Kirk Road Service Station to St David's House via Shotts Station and Polkemmet Road in around 2h.
